Check connection to the nodes
By running the Check Node Interfaces task, you can check if the selected Dell EMC device or DRAC/IDRAC and its
corresponding interfaces are reachable. After the task is successfully run, a summary of the reachability to the server and
interface is displayed.
View warranty information of PowerEdge servers
By running the Get Warranty Information task, you can view the warranty status of the Dell EMC device.
Start OMSA on monolithic servers using the SCOM console
By running the Launch Dell OpenManage Server Administrator task, you can start the Dell OMSA application.

Start iDRAC using the SCOM console
By running the Launch Dell EMC Remote Access Console task, you can start the Dell iDRAC application.
Start Remote Desktop on monolithic servers using the SCOM
console
By running the Launch Dell EMC Remote Desktop task, you can start a Remote Desktop on Dell EMC monolithic servers.
NOTE:
You can start Dell EMC Remote Desktop only if Windows operating system is installed, and Remote Desktop is
manually enabled on the managed node.
